...so much rings true to me, because i know about the missing and what it feels like to be a person displaced as well.

Indeed, these families gather every year for decades, Turkish and Greek to discuss the progress in their advocacy for Justice.

...a day of commemoration they suggest for the missing who may have died at the hands of "Greeks" or "Turks" but for "being" Cypriot. A memorial they hope to build, where on that day they may share together this understanding in a public way.
